White Marshall is an unreleased special Funkey.
Trivia
- White Marshall is never seen in the game.
- White Marshall was intended to be a lighter, friendlier version of Marshall for Daydream Oasis, representing the theme of parallels between light and dark.
- A prototype version of White Marshall was seen at the 2009 New York Toy Fair. It is unknown what happened to the figure.
